如何安装和使用 Git Large File Storage (LFS)
Git LFS 是一个开源的 Git 扩展,用于替换 Git 仓库中的大文件,用指针文件替代实际的大文件。这样,你可以在保持仓库轻量级的同时,有效地管理大型文件。
成为git砖家(5): 理解 HEAD
在 Pro Git 这本书中很好的解释了HEAD 的概念: 指向当前所在的分支。作为验证, 可以通过查看.git/HEAD文件内容,或命令来确认。HEAD表示当前分支的别名。当切换分支,.git/HEAD就变化了。查看.git/HEAD并不是很直观, 直观的方式是用命令, 以及这样的写法。进一步的,
Git 详解(原理、使用)
git 的原理及使用详细讲解
【git指南】git 本地代码版本控制
当对已上传的文件进行修改过后,修改部分代码会左侧会有颜色提示,绿色表示这里是新加的代码,红色代表此处代码被删除,蓝色代表此处代码被修改。界面可以看见所有历史版本信息,左侧有版本名称即为你添加的注释(可以相同)和上传时间,右侧有版本的hash码(不同),是版本的唯一标识符。点击+号,在消息框输入版
Git安装与使用及整合IDEA使用的详细教程
版本控制软件提供完备的版本管理功能,用于存储、追踪目录(文件夹)和文件的修改历史,是软件开发者的必备工具,是软件公司的基础设施。版本控制软件的最高目标,是支持软件公司的配置管理活动,追踪多个版本的开发和维护活动,及时发布软件。编程中的代码版本控制工具是软件开发过程中不可或缺的一部分。它能够帮助开发团
Git的基本命令操作超详细解析教程
本地仓库:是指 Git 存储项目历史记录的地方,它保存了项目的每一次提交,每个提交都包含了一个快照和提交信息。首先在main创建main1、2、3分别提交三次,在dev分支中创建dev1、dev2分别提交二次,然后在main中创建main4、main5提交二次。再新创建一个文件file2.txt,进
TortoiseGit的使用详解
然后A修改了,A想上传代码,发现冲突了,原因是A依靠的是1版本的代码进行了修改,而此时远程仓库的代码是2版本,这样当然会产生冲突。当从远程仓库拉取代码时,代码会直接拉取到工作区,然后我们要添加、提交,然后才可以把拉取的代码放入本地仓库,本地仓库的代码可以通过推送,推送到远程仓库,这是一个大循环。解决
Git的安装与卸载详细流程(非常详细,亲测可用)
在windows所在用户中会残留global级别的配置以及Git的凭证信息,我们进入用户目录删除.gitconfig和.git-credentials文件,如图2-14所示。在浏览器地址栏输入:https://github.com/git-for-windows/git/releases,进入Git
深耕版本控制、代码质量与安全等领域,龙智荣获“Perforce 2023年度合作伙伴”奖项
龙智是一家DevSecOps解决方案提供商,专注于软件开发运营一体化领域十多年,集成DevSecOps、ITSM、Agile管理思路及该领域的优秀工具,提供从产品规划与需求管理、开发,到测试、部署以及运维全生命周期的解决方案,通过专业咨询、方案定制、实施部署、专业培训、定制开发等一站式服务,帮助企业
一步到位!快速精通Git工作流及实战技巧详解
Git是一个分布式版本控制系统。
Git教程-Git的基本使用
本文学习了Git的基本概念和常用命令,旨在帮助读者建立扎实的版本控制基础。通过详细介绍Git的安装、配置、基本工作流、分支管理、远程仓库等方面,读者将深入理解Git在团队协作和代码管理中的关键作用。学完本教程后,读者不仅将具备Git的基本技能,更能运用灵活的工作流程解决实际项目中的复杂场景。 Git
创建 Git 仓库
什么是仓库呢?仓库又名版本库,英文名,你可以简单理解成一个目录,这个目录里面的所有文件都可以被Git管理起来,每个文件的修改、删除,Git都能跟踪,以便任何时刻都可以追踪历史,或者在将来某个时刻可以“还原”。
【Git 入门教程】第四节、Git冲突:如何解决版本控制的矛盾
本文详细讲解在多人协作开发中Git冲突的常见的问题,用什么措施和方法去解决Git冲突、以及如何避免Git冲突。
【Git 入门教程】第三节、Git的分支和合并
在本文中,我们将介绍Git分支的基本概念和操作方式。如使用Git创建、切换和合并分支等
git命令的使用
git命令的使用
关于Git这一篇就够了
目录前言发展过程集中式与分布式的区别Debian/Linux安装Git配置git环境:git config --global创建本地空仓库:git init新建文件添加到本地仓库:git add、git commit -m改写提交:git commit --amend查看历史提交日志:git log
关于Git这一篇就够了
目录前言发展过程集中式与分布式的区别Debian/Linux安装Git配置git环境:git config --global创建本地空仓库:git init新建文件添加到本地仓库:git add、git commit -m改写提交:git commit --amend查看历史提交日志:git log
Git工具--教你如何从安装到掌握
Git是一个开源的分布式版本控制系统,可以有效、高速地处理从很小到非常大的项目版本管理。它是Linux之父为了帮助管理 Linux 内核开发而开发的一个开放源码的版本控制软件。目前公司使用较多的是集中式版本控制SVN和分布式版本控制Git。本文不对具体原理及专有名词死磕,将带你从Git工具的安装到基